Subject: DR drill — log sampling for Chirpline

Hello plugin authors,

During next week's disaster-recovery drill, the Chirpline ingest service will run with aggressive log sampling (1 in 50) to keep storage costs sane. Expect gaps in debug output; do not file noise reports. If your plugin needs the sampled-log replay bucket, unlock it with the passphrase below.

unlock words, yagep-fahof: belix-rusvan-casdor-gorox-aldath-norael-istix-quenael-fraeth-silael

Subject: Log sampling ownership change

Team,

Sampling config for the Brightcask ingest service now lives in the platform repo, not ops. Default rate drops to 5% next sprint; noisy endpoints get per-route overrides. New folks: don't touch sampling rules without review — Brightcask emits enough to melt the aggregator. All sampling questions and change requests now go to the new owner.

approver of yawig-yajef = Briius Jorix

**14:22 — Firmware channel rollback initiated.** The Lumenrail device-firmware update channel began serving the 3.2 image to beta-ring devices ahead of schedule due to a misconfigured ring filter. On-call paused the channel, reverted the filter, and re-pinned beta devices to 3.1. No field units bricked. Affected rollout batch was rebuilt and re-signed; the release manager should verify the rollback build against the trace token recorded below.

pipeline stamp: htk31_f769b577b3028a4e9958e5bb8d1259a

# Break-Glass: Catalog Cache Invalidation

Scope: the Pinrow product catalog at Veldstone Retail. If stale prices persist after a purge and the Hollowmere invalidation queue is wedged, use break-glass to flush the edge tier directly. Contractors: get verbal sign-off from the catalog lead first. Steps: open the Hollowmere admin shell, select emergency-flush, confirm the tenant, and run it once — repeated flushes thrash the origin. Access is logged and expires after 20 minutes. Unseal the admin shell with the passphrase below.

recovery phrase for kahop-tajog: istix-casvan